Course Details

Cloud Architecture Fundamentals: Understanding cloud computing, architecture patterns, and deployment models.
Designing for Scalability: Techniques for creating horizontally and vertically scalable cloud systems.
High Availability and Fault Tolerance: Designing cloud systems for maximum uptime and resilience.
Disaster Recovery and Business Continuity: Planning and implementing disaster recovery strategies in the cloud.
Security best practices in cloud architecture: Implementing security measures to protect data, systems, and users.
Cost Optimization: Techniques for reducing cloud infrastructure costs while maintaining performance.
Monitoring and Logging: Tools and techniques for monitoring and analyzing cloud infrastructure performance.
Designing for Data Management: Strategies for managing data storage, retrieval, and processing in the cloud.
Containerization and Serverless Architecture: Leveraging containers and serverless computing for cloud reliability.

With a focus on the UK job market, the chart showcases the percentage of professionals employed in various roles related to cloud architecture. Here are the roles and their respective percentages: 1. Cloud Architect: 45% - These professionals design and manage cloud environments, ensuring they meet the needs of their organizations. 2. DevOps Engineer: 25% - DevOps engineers facilitate collaboration between development and operations teams, automating and streamlining processes. 3. Security Specialist: 15% - Security specialists protect cloud infrastructure from threats and vulnerabilities, ensuring data privacy and compliance. 4. Data Engineer: 10% - Data engineers build and maintain data infrastructures, enabling the processing and analysis of large-scale datasets. 5. Network Engineer: 5% - Network engineers design and implement network architectures, ensuring seamless communication between cloud services and users.
